Dimensions & Specifications
The Jewel Royale Chess Set is designed to fit seamlessly into your living space, with dimensions that make it ideal for standard dining tables. The set measures 2 inches in height, 14 inches in depth, and 10 inches in width, making it a striking addition to your tabletop. Weighing in at 4.38 lbs, it is substantial enough to convey quality while remaining easy to handle during play. The edge profile features a sophisticated Dupont finish, ensuring a smooth and refined look.
Care Instructions
To maintain the beauty and integrity of your Jewel Royale Chess Set, gently wipe the pieces with a soft, dry cloth after each use to remove fingerprints and dust.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that could damage the finish. Store the set in a cool, dry place when not in use, and consider using a protective case to preserve its exquisite appearance for years to come.
